The document describes a workshop on measuring physician relations return on investment. It discusses how three organizations, including Baystate Health, demonstrate results from their physician relations programs. At Baystate Health, their physician liaison program led to $8 million in new annual revenue, a 25 to 1 return on their $316,000 investment. Their liaisons conduct over 1,400 face-to-face visits annually and help fill new specialist panels 50% faster. The workshop aims to help others learn from these examples on tracking measures that align with goals and demonstrating physician relations program value.
